我想创建一个闪亮的应用程序,以绘制表格内各种数据的图形。我创建了闪亮的应用程序,
告诉用户选择要绘制的文件
将数据文件加载到数据数据库中
向用户询问要绘制哪一列
将各种数据插入各自的数据帧
然后绘制相应的选定列
代码如下
library(shiny)
library(ggplot2)
ui <- fluidPage(
titlePanel("Creating a database"),
sidebarLayout(
sidebarPanel(
textInput("name", "Company Name"),
numericInput("income", "Income", value = 1),
numericInput("expenditure", "Expenditure", value = 1),
dateInput("date", h3("Date input"),value = Sys.Date() ,min = "0000-01-01",
max = Sys.Date(), format = "dd/mm/yy"),
actionButton("Action", "Submit"),#Submit Button
actionButton("new", "New")),
mainPanel(
tabsetPanel(type = "tabs",
tabPanel("Table", tableOutput("table")),
tabPanel("Download",
textInput("filename", "Enter Filename for download"), #filename
helpText(strong("Warning: Append if want to update existing data.")),
downloadButton('downloadData', 'Download'), #Button to save the file
downloadButton('Appenddata', 'Append')),#Button to update a file )
tabPanel("Plot",
actionButton("filechoose", "Choose File"),
br(),
selectInput("toplot", "To Plot", choices = c("Income" = "inc",
"Expenditure" = "exp",
"Gross Profit" = "gprofit",
"Net Profit" = "nprofit"
)),
actionButton("plotit", "PLOT"),
plotOutput("Plot"))
)
)
)
)
# Define server logic required to draw a histogram
server <- function(input, output){
#Global variable to save the data
Data <- data.frame()
Results <- reactive(data.frame(input$name, input$income, input$expenditure,
as.character(input$date),
as.character(Sys.Date())))
#To append the row and display in the table when the submit button is clicked
observeEvent(input$Action,{
Data <<- rbind(Data,Results()) #Append the row in the dataframe
output$table <- renderTable(Data) #Display the output in the table
})
observeEvent(input$new, {
Data <<- NULL
output$table <- renderTable(Data)
})
observeEvent(input$filechoose, {
Data <<- read.csv(file.choose()) #Choose file to plot
inc <- as.numeric(Data[ ,2])
exp <- as.numeric(Data[ ,3])
date <- Data[,4]
gprofit <- exp - inc
nprofit <- (exp - inc) * 0.06
output$table <- renderTable(Data) #Display the choosen file details
})
output$downloadData <- downloadHandler(
filename = function() {
paste(input$filename , ".csv", sep="")}, # Create the download file name
content = function(file) {
write.csv(Data, file,row.names = FALSE) # download data
})
output$Appenddata <- downloadHandler(
filename = function() {
paste(input$filename, ".csv", sep="")},
content = function(file) {
write.table( Data, file=file.choose(),append = T, sep=',',
row.names = FALSE, col.names = FALSE) # Append data in existing
})
observeEvent(input$plotit, {
bab <- input$toplot
output$Plot <- renderPlot("Plot",
ggplot()+ geom_bar(data = Data, aes(x= input$toplot,
y= date)))})
}
# Run the application
shinyApp(ui = ui, server = server)
但是当我按下“绘图”按钮时,它给出了错误
Error in *: non-numeric argument to binary operator`
我哪里错了?我也使用as.numeric将数据转换为数字,以消除错误。公开征求建议以对其进行更改。请帮忙。谢谢。

使用switch() statement usage中的开关盒 或How to use the switch statement in R functions?来帮助您进行选择。
library(shiny)
library(ggplot2)
ui <- fluidPage(
titlePanel("Creating a database"),
sidebarLayout(
sidebarPanel(
textInput("name", "Company Name"),
numericInput("income", "Income", value = 1),
numericInput("expenditure", "Expenditure", value = 1),
dateInput("date", h3("Date input"),value = Sys.Date() ,min = "0000-01-01",
max = Sys.Date(), format = "dd/mm/yy"),
actionButton("Action", "Submit"),#Submit Button
actionButton("new", "New")),
mainPanel(
tabsetPanel(type = "tabs",
tabPanel("Table", tableOutput("table")),
tabPanel("Download",
textInput("filename", "Enter Filename for download"), #filename
helpText(strong("Warning: Append if want to update existing data.")),
downloadButton('downloadData', 'Download'), #Button to save the file
downloadButton('Appenddata', 'Append')),#Button to update a file )
tabPanel("Plot",
actionButton("filechoose", "Choose File"),
br(),
selectInput("toplot", "To Plot", choices = c("Income" = "inc",
"Expenditure" = "exp",
"Gross Profit" = "gprofit",
"Net Profit" = "nprofit"
)),
actionButton("plotit", "PLOT"),
plotOutput("Plot")
)
)
)
)
)
# Define server logic required to draw a histogram
server <- function(input, output){
#Global variable to save the data
Data <- data.frame()
Results <- reactive(data.frame(input$name, input$income, input$expenditure,
as.character(input$date),
as.character(Sys.Date())))
#To append the row and display in the table when the submit button is clicked
observeEvent(input$Action,{
Data <<- rbind(Data,Results()) #Append the row in the dataframe
output$table <- renderTable(Data) #Display the output in the table
})
observeEvent(input$new, {
Data <<- NULL
output$table <- renderTable(Data)
})
observeEvent(input$filechoose, {
Data <<- read.csv(file.choose()) #Choose file to plot
output$table <- renderTable(Data) #Display the choosen file details
})
output$downloadData <- downloadHandler(
filename = function() {
paste(input$filename , ".csv", sep="")}, # Create the download file name
content = function(file) {
write.csv(Data, file,row.names = FALSE) # download data
})
output$Appenddata <- downloadHandler(
filename = function() {
paste(input$filename, ".csv", sep="")},
content = function(file) {
write.table( Data, file=file.choose(),append = T, sep=',',
row.names = FALSE, col.names = FALSE) # Append data in existing
})
observeEvent(input$plotit, {
inc <- c(Data[ ,2])
exp <- c(Data[ ,3])
date <- c(Data[,4])
gprofit <- c(Data[ ,3]- Data[ ,2])
nprofit <- (exp - inc) * 0.06
y = input$toplot
switch(EXPR = y ,
inc = output$Plot <- renderPlot(ggplot(data = Data, aes(x= date, y= inc))+
geom_bar(stat = "identity",
fill = "blue")+xlab("Dates")+
ylab("Income")),
exp = output$Plot <- renderPlot(ggplot(data = Data, aes(x= date, y= exp))+
geom_bar(stat = "identity",
fill = "blue")+xlab("Dates")+
ylab("Expenditure")),
gprofit = output$Plot <- renderPlot(ggplot(data = Data, aes(x= date, y= gprofit))+
geom_bar(stat = "identity",
fill = "blue")+xlab("Dates")+
ylab("Gross Profit")),
nprofit = output$Plot <- renderPlot(ggplot(data = Data, aes(x= date, y= nprofit))+
geom_bar(stat = "identity",
fill = "blue")+xlab("Dates")+
ylab("Net Profit")))})
}
# Run the application
shinyApp(ui = ui, server = server)
